An unsuspecting investor recently sent over $7,000 worth of Bitcoin to an address assumed to be connected to Satoshi Nakamoto, the elusive founder of Bitcoin, in a mistake that shocked the cryptocurrency community. The unfortunate incident happened when someone tried to take part in a token sacrifice for the PUPS token, a meme coin derived from Bitcoin.

This expensive error has sparked new debate about the identity of Satoshi Nakamoto and what will happen to the Bitcoin that is kept in wallets connected to the mysterious individual. Though Nakamoto’s addresses contain large sums of Bitcoin, they have been idle for years, which has piqued the interest and speculation of fans.

The condition of the inactive addresses remains unchanged, as there is no sign that the Bitcoin supplied would be accessed or transferred, notwithstanding the accidental transfer. The digital currency community has responded with a mixture of shock and empathy, with many highlighting the need of verifying transaction data twice in the unpredictable cryptocurrency market.

The episode also emphasizes the dangers of cryptocurrency transactions, where a single typing mistake can have permanent repercussions. With Bitcoin’s value standing around $67,000 at the time of the occurrence, the transferred BTC would have been enormous, emphasizing the importance of prudence and monitoring when conducting digital asset transactions.
